How they compare

Philippines currently reports 126.06 DOD, current US$ per person against 117.74 DOD, current US$ per person in Zambia, a difference of 8.32 DOD, current US$ per person.

That makes Philippines's figure about 1.1 times Zambia's.

The two have swapped places 9 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Zambia ahead.

Philippines ranks 59th and Zambia ranks 62nd of 122 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Philippines averaged higher in 1 and Zambia in 5.

Head to head by decade

Decade Philippines Zambia Difference Ahead
1970s 7.08 DOD, current US$ per person 35.33 DOD, current US$ per person 28.25 DOD, current US$ per person Zambia
1980s 43.89 DOD, current US$ per person 76.19 DOD, current US$ per person 32.3 DOD, current US$ per person Zambia
1990s 65.32 DOD, current US$ per person 144.74 DOD, current US$ per person 79.42 DOD, current US$ per person Zambia
2000s 37.41 DOD, current US$ per person 133.96 DOD, current US$ per person 96.54 DOD, current US$ per person Zambia
2010s 42.04 DOD, current US$ per person 44.02 DOD, current US$ per person 1.98 DOD, current US$ per person Zambia
2020s 97.21 DOD, current US$ per person 92.95 DOD, current US$ per person 4.26 DOD, current US$ per person Philippines

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
